(WikiImages/Pixabay) Scientists have reported the discovery of the smallest star ever found, detecting a star only slightly larger than Saturn some 600 light-years away from Earth. The star, called EBLM J0555–57Ab, is part of a binary system – as it orbits another, much larger star – and the ... Webb28 juli 2024 · Most white dwarfs are closer to Earth’s size. Webb24 mars 2024 · However, there is a rare star type that is created in the process of star death that is smaller than the Earth. Neutron stars are the result of very large stars exploding and pushing away their outer gas layers, leaving only the internal core behind. These stars are usually less than 13 miles in diameter, but have a very high mass. Webb31 mars 2024 · The Short Answer: To weigh a planet, scientists need to know two things: how long it takes objects to orbit the planet and how far away those objects are from the planet. The time it takes an object to orbit a planet depends on its distance from the planet and the planet’s weight. In real life, we can’t pick up a planet and put it on a scale.
